Output dd65f6426bd1c63a7412ac2d90dec253b4063514b92499ec0c759706fab7f49f:8

value
2383754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ef6eb1ea02ce18e06606599d8a2e0a8e57f7d50f OP_EQUALVERIFY OP_CHECKSIG
address
1Nq17529YzPbXGig2iRGWNpS2yYaLztTwc
transaction
dd65f6426bd1c63a7412ac2d90dec253b4063514b92499ec0c759706fab7f49f
spent
true